I use the medium stay car park, which is easy to locate and suits our needs nicely. We are regular travellers to our property abroad and our return flight arrives in Newcastle in the early hours of the morning. What infuriates me is the exit barrier, that invariably doesn't open when I follow the prescribed procedure. This necessitates a visit to the onsite office and a delay in leaving the car park. At silly o'clock in the morning and work next day it annoyed me considerably. So much so that we started flying from Leeds Bradford, however, circumstances meant we couldn't this time. I suppose the only consolation was I was expecting problems; sad really.

On arriving at Newcastle airport, I dropped my wife and 2 friends off at the short stay car park, whilst we unloaded the cases for our holiday and paid the £2.50. They took the cases whilst i parked the car, which i proceeded to do. Collected by a nice friendly bus / coach driver. On our return my wife and friends collect the bags and i hurried off to the coach/bus to be transported to my car(again another friendly driver). On collecting my car, presented the ticket to machine which was refused, barrier failed to raise, tried again nothing, I returned to the manned station / reception to be told that because id drove into the short stay car park the camera had recognized the number plate and it had registered me entering and exiting twice in my parking allocation that's not allowed. He then done something to my ticket and i went on my way to the barriers, only for them to fail to raise again. i left the car at the barriers, walk back to the station whereupon the gentleman came back out the the barrier and raised it with a swipe card. The speed of which I'd had hoped never materialized. Overall its a great system, but driving into one car park and dropping off suit cases and parking in another shouldn't cause that much of a problems!
